21 #define CIFS_DEBUG              /* BB temporary */
22
23 #ifndef _H_CIFS_DEBUG
24 #define _H_CIFS_DEBUG
25
26 void cifs_dump_mem(char *label, void *data, int length);
27 #ifdef CONFIG_CIFS_DEBUG2
28 #define DBG2 2
29 void cifs_dump_detail(struct smb_hdr *);
30 void cifs_dump_mids(struct TCP_Server_Info *);
31 #else
32 #define DBG2 0
33 #endif
34 extern int traceSMB;            /* flag which enables the function below */
35 void dump_smb(struct smb_hdr *, int);
36 #define CIFS_INFO       0x01
37 #define CIFS_RC         0x02
38 #define CIFS_TIMER      0x04
39
40 /*
41  *      debug ON
42  *      --------
43  */
44 #ifdef CIFS_DEBUG
45
46 /* information message: e.g., configuration, major event */
47 extern int cifsFYI;
48 #define cifsfyi(fmt, arg...)                                            \
49 do {                                                                    \
50         if (cifsFYI & CIFS_INFO)                                        \
51                 printk(KERN_DEBUG "%s: " fmt "\n", __FILE__, ##arg);    \
52 } while (0)
53
54 #define cFYI(set, fmt, arg...)                  \
55 do {                                            \
56         if (set)                                \
57                 cifsfyi(fmt, ##arg);            \
58 } while (0)
59
60 #define cifswarn(fmt, arg...)                   \
61         printk(KERN_WARNING fmt "\n", ##arg)
62
63 /* debug event message: */
64 extern int cifsERROR;
65
66 #define cEVENT(fmt, arg...)                                             \
67 do {                                                                    \
68         if (cifsERROR)                                                  \
69                 printk(KERN_EVENT "%s: " fmt "\n", __FILE__, ##arg);    \
70 } while (0)
71
72 /* error event message: e.g., i/o error */
73 #define cifserror(fmt, arg...)                                  \
74 do {                                                            \
75         if (cifsERROR)                                          \
76                 printk(KERN_ERR "CIFS VFS: " fmt "\n", ##arg);  \
77 } while (0)
78
79 #define cERROR(set, fmt, arg...)                \
80 do {                                            \
81         if (set)                                \
82                 cifserror(fmt, ##arg);          \
83 } while (0)
84
85 /*
86  *      debug OFF
87  *      ---------
88  */
89 #else           /* _CIFS_DEBUG */
90 #define cERROR(set, fmt, arg...)
91 #define cEVENT(fmt, arg...)
92 #define cFYI(set, fmt, arg...)
93 #define cifserror(fmt, arg...)
94 #endif          /* _CIFS_DEBUG */
95
96 #endif                          /* _H_CIFS_DEBUG */
